Review: Olay Quench Body Lotion
I’ve used Olay Quench
Body Lotion for years. My mum gave this to me when I was a teenager and for
me then, the best part of it was wearing body lotion with glitter in it. What
could be more perfect? I haven’t used the glitter version in years though.
This body lotion has a nice blend of vitamins – much more
than the average body lotion. It contains Niacinamide (Vitamin B3), Tocopherol
(Vitamin E) and Panthenol (Vitamin B5). It also contains Petrolatum to seal in
moisture so it is not advisable to use on the face. I recently used the Advanced Healing version which is the
most hydrating and doesn’t contain fragrance making it suitable for sensitive
skin types. You get 600ml of a wonderful fast absorbing formula that spreads
easily. The packaging is great to preserve the ingredients and comes with a
pump and I love that you can open it when it’s almost finished to get the last
of the product out.

If you are wondering, Olay can be used for fair or dark skin.
It does not lighten the skin and it is completely safe to use during pregnancy.
There are a variety of options in the range so you may have a hard time
deciding what Olay product is right for you. The formulas are quite similar but
usually have one unique ingredient. Ultra-Moisture
for example contains Shea Butter while Shimmer
contains Cocoa Butter and light-reflecting minerals that will make your skin
literally shimmer.
